Output 8482d4110d30a38df2c0356f66ecf62a90fbd612ee087e9ca64a0baaf59a08e6:9

value
26513
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7e310baecaf4b26a427a17a469500986a327aeb4 OP_EQUAL
address
3DCFpTvD2q8V6fcyJW7QmW6cbTjdGSsCBq
transaction
8482d4110d30a38df2c0356f66ecf62a90fbd612ee087e9ca64a0baaf59a08e6
spent
true